Trailer: Matteo Garrone’s ‘Reality’

[ , , , , ]

‘GOMORRAH’ DIRECTOR’S DELUSIONAL ‘BIG BROTHER’ FANTASY IS AN EXPLORATION OF A FAME-OBSESSED FISH MONGER IN ITALY

What’s it take to get on the ‘Big Brother’ reality TV show and what happens when you don’t make it? This surreal Buñuelian follow-up to director Matteo Garrone’s gangster drama ‘Gomorrah’ mesmerized some at Cannes and had many comparing it to Martin Scorsese’s brilliant ‘King of Comedy’. Some people hated it. Interestingly, Scorsese produced ‘Gomorrah’.

The trailer makes it feel a little like ‘Slumdog Millionaire’ set in Italy and instead of ‘Who Wants To Be A Millionaire’, the game show of choice is ‘Big Brother’. It could go either way, but it definitely looks interesting.

‘Reality’ will be released on March 15th in New York and March 22nd in Los Angeles.
